CHEVROLET TRAIL BLAZER 2004 1.G Owners Manual Rainsense™ Wipers
Your vehicle may be equipped with
Rainsense™ windshield wipers. When active, these
wipers are able to detect moisture on the windshield and
automatically turn on the wipers.

CHEVROLET TRAIL BLAZER 2004 1.G Owners Manual Safety Belt Reminder Light
When the key is turned to RUN, a chime will come on
for several seconds to remind people to fasten their
safety belts, unless the driver’s safety belt is already
buckled.
